Solution : https://service.sap.com/sap/support/notes/1410294 (Connexion à SAP Service Marketplace requise)
Résumé :
La Note SAP traite des insuffisances du support de l'algorithme SHA-2 dans les modules de fonction ABAP pour les opérations de hash et HMAC. Auparavant, des modules tels que CALCULATE_HASH_FOR_CHAR et CALCULATE_HASH_FOR_RAW ne supportaient pas le SHA-2, tandis que le calcul de HMAC avec des clés privées était impossible. La mise à jour introduit la conformité SHA-2 (SHA-256, SHA-384, SHA-512) à travers de nouvelles classes ABAP OO (CL_ABAP_MESSAGE_DIGEST, CL_ABAP_HMAC), remplaçant les fonctions obsolètes. Les mises à jour nécessitent des améliorations du Kernel ABAP et du Support Package, avec des ajustements également nécessaires dans la bibliothèque SAPCrypto selon la note SAP 1415576. L'implémentation assure la compatibilité avec les méthodes en flux continu et statiques pour une fonctionnalité cryptographique améliorée.
Mots Clés :
sha-2 algorithms sha-256 sha-384 sha-512, hash calculation modules calculate_hash_for_char calculate_hash_for_raw, hashed message authentication codes, abap support package update, sha-2 algorithm names, stream based mode, statick methods replace, function modules calculate_hash_for_char, abap oo classes, abap kernel update
Notes associées :
1415576 |